Brian:welcome: when the tops down crack the bottom lines loose at the cylinders and when you push the top down re tighten the hyd. lines (you may need a helper)! That should relieve the pressure holding the top up a little at the bottom of the cylinders! If it doesn't help see if there is another hole to mount the cylinders in to lower them? If there isn't I don't know? If your top and cage are new your cage may be binding a little and will free up with use. Your cover will also shrink LoL and stretch when installed in the sun!!! If can warm the cover and snap it down and keep it warm for a while it should loosen up. Jester |
